Understanding the Current Rating
The Strong Sell rating indicates that MarketsMOJO’s analysis suggests investors should exercise caution with Invigorated Business Consulting Ltd. This recommendation is based on a comprehensive evaluation of four key parameters: Quality, Valuation, Financial Trend, and Technicals. Each of these factors contributes to the overall assessment of the stock’s risk and potential performance in the near to medium term.
Quality Assessment
As of 12 February 2026, the company’s quality grade is classified as below average. This reflects concerns about the firm’s fundamental strength, particularly its long-term viability. Notably, Invigorated Business Consulting Ltd reports a negative book value, signalling that its liabilities exceed its assets on the balance sheet. This is a significant red flag for investors, as it implies weak financial health and potential solvency risks.
Further, the company’s net sales have declined at an annual rate of -0.61%, while operating profit has remained stagnant at 0%. Such flat or negative growth trends undermine confidence in the company’s ability to generate sustainable earnings and expand its business over time.
Valuation Considerations
The valuation grade for Invigorated Business Consulting Ltd is currently rated as risky. The stock trades at levels that are unfavourable compared to its historical averages, suggesting that it may be overvalued relative to its earnings and cash flow prospects. Additionally, the company’s EBITDA is negative, which further compounds valuation concerns as it indicates operational losses before accounting for interest, taxes, depreciation, and amortisation.
Investors should note that risky valuation metrics often imply heightened downside potential, especially if the company fails to improve its profitability or growth trajectory.
Financial Trend Analysis
The financial trend for the company is assessed as flat. The latest data shows that profits have declined by approximately 10% over the past year, while the stock itself has generated a return of 0.00% during the same period. This lack of positive momentum in earnings and share price performance highlights the challenges the company faces in delivering shareholder value.
Moreover, the company’s results for December 2025 were flat, indicating no significant improvement or deterioration in recent quarters. Such stagnation can be a warning sign for investors seeking growth opportunities.
Technical Outlook
From a technical perspective, the stock is mildly bearish. Recent price movements show volatility, with a notable 9.67% decline in a single day as of 12 February 2026. Over the past six months, the stock has fallen by 31.21%, and over three months by 20.66%, underperforming broader market indices and sector peers.
This bearish technical trend suggests that market sentiment towards Invigorated Business Consulting Ltd remains weak, which may continue to pressure the stock price in the near term.
Performance Summary
As of 12 February 2026, the stock’s short-term returns show mixed signals: a 4.51% gain over the past week contrasts with declines over longer periods, including a 1.26% drop in the last month and a 1.42% decrease year-to-date. The absence of a one-year return figure reflects either insufficient data or extreme volatility. Overall, the stock has underperformed the market and its sector peers, reinforcing the cautious stance reflected in the Strong Sell rating.
Sector and Market Context
Invigorated Business Consulting Ltd operates within the Commercial Services & Supplies sector, a space that often demands consistent operational efficiency and growth to maintain investor confidence. The company’s microcap status adds an additional layer of risk, as smaller firms typically face greater challenges in liquidity and market visibility.
Given these factors, the current rating advises investors to carefully evaluate the risks before considering exposure to this stock.
Fresh entry alert! This Small Cap from Electronics & Appliances sector is already turning heads in our Top 1% club. Get ahead of the market now!
- - New Top 1% entry
- - Market attention building
- - Early positioning opportunity
What This Rating Means for Investors
The Strong Sell rating from MarketsMOJO serves as a cautionary signal for investors. It suggests that the stock currently carries significant risks that outweigh potential rewards. Investors should consider the company’s weak fundamentals, risky valuation, flat financial trends, and bearish technical indicators before making investment decisions.
For those holding the stock, this rating may prompt a review of portfolio exposure and risk tolerance. For prospective investors, it advises prudence and thorough due diligence, as the stock’s outlook does not currently support a positive investment thesis.
Conclusion
Invigorated Business Consulting Ltd’s Strong Sell rating, last updated on 11 Nov 2025, reflects a comprehensive assessment of its current challenges and risks. As of 12 February 2026, the company’s financial and market data confirm ongoing difficulties in growth, profitability, and market sentiment. Investors should weigh these factors carefully and consider alternative opportunities with stronger fundamentals and more favourable valuations.
Upgrade at special rates, valid only for the next few days. Claim Your Special Rate →
